VIA together with Gigabyte and ABIT deliver the high performance platform for the gaming finals of NGL Europe during the Games Convention in Leipzig

Taipei, Taiwan and Leipzig, Germany, 19 August 2004 - VIA Technologies, Inc, a leading innovator and developer of silicon chip technologies and PC platform solutions, today announced sponsorship of the gaming finals of the Network Gaming League (NGL, Netzstatt Gaming League) taking place at Games Convention 2004 in Leipzig from August 19 till August 22. As the part of the cooperation with NGL, VIA has teamed up with Gigabyte and ABIT to sponsor the PC systems on which the top German teams will play the finals of NGL.

The NGL Finals, with prize money of EUR50,000, will be the highlight of the Games Convention at Leipzig. The best teams from Germany, Austria and Switzerland will vie for the NGL Europe Champion crown, playing on 200 PC systems powered by the award-winning VIA K8T800 Pro chipset.

The gaming systems used in the NGL Europe finals are powered by VIA K8T800 Pro performance chipset, combining amazing performance on the AMD64 platform with a blistering 1GHz Hyper-Transport chipset to processor interconnect, with support for VIA Vinyl Audio, native Serial ATA, multi-configuration V-RAID, as well as superior overclocking features, fitting perfectly with the requirements of gamers who demand only the best.

About NGL Europe

The NGL (Netzstatt Gaming League) is the organizer of the German, Austrian and Swiss Championships of Computer Games. The disciplines of this season in Germany are Battlefield 1942, Counter-Strike, Far Cry, FIFA Football 2004, Warcraft III: The Frozen Throne, C&C Generals and Need for Speed Underground. The visitors are able to follow the important games on two canvases and listen to the moderators and competent game commentators to dive into the world of eSport.
